About Sierra Vista Steam Academy

Sierra Vista Steam Academy is a public elementary school in EL Paso, TX, part of SOCORRO ISD. Sierra Vista Steam Academy serves approximately 632 students, and covers grades Pre-K-5th, and has a 20.4:1 student-teacher ratio. Sierra Vista Steam Academy has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.1 out of 10 and ranks #6,324 of 8,552 schools in TX.

Structured state assessment records for Sierra Vista Steam Academy show 60%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 64%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

What Parents Should Know

Sierra Vista Steam Academy runs 20.4:1 students to teachers, above the national average. That often means bigger classes. Ask how the school supports kids who need extra help, and whether there are teaching assistants or small-group time.
